Marvel Legends re-releases of the Retro Carded Cell Shaded Spider-Man, and the X-Force 3-Pack of Rictor, Domino, and Cannonball

Hasbro is re-issuing two more previous Marvel Legends releases in the shape of the Retro Carded Cell-Shaded Spider-Man and the X-Force 3-Pack.
Spider-Man, first released in 2022, was originally a Walmart Exclusive. He comes with alternative hands and web effects.
The X-Force set, featuring Rictor, Domino, and Cannonball, was first released in 2021 and at that time was a shared exclusive between Hasbro Pulse and Disney Store.
Both of these re-releases have general availability through Legends stockists. Shipping dates vary, with some UK retailers having Spider-Man due in October and the X-Force set in November. Entertainment Earth is quoting a January 2027 release. We've added them to our fully comprehensive Marvel Legends Collector Database
